The new trade deal struck between the EU and India could open the door to a long-coveted market for aircraft lessors. On Tuesday, the EU and India inked an expansive trade deal that includes slashing tariffs on European aircraft and parts entering India to zero from the current 11 per cent. Aviation leasing is a massive industry in Ireland, with a large chunk of the sector headquartered here, serving global markets but long facing barriers to entry in India. “Having aviation included [in the trade deal], I don’t know how much people expected that,” said Robert Kokonis, president and managing…
